Ein optionales Argument ist ein Argument, das weggelassen werden kann und eventuell durch einen Standardwert ersetzt wird, wobei ein Argument ein tatsächlicher Wert ist, der an eine Funktion, Prozedur oder ein Befehlszeilenprogramm übergeben wird.
Ich habe ein Stück Code, das eine Funktion definiert, die eine Funktion als Argument akzeptiert:
%Vor%
Nun möchte ich einen Standardwert von f angeben, der nichts tut. Also nahm ich an, dass ich pass so verwenden würde:
%Vor%
Aber das ko...
28.02.2011, 09:57
Ich wollte eine tail-rekursive Version von List.map haben, also habe ich meine eigene geschrieben. Hier ist es:
%Vor%
Immer wenn ich diese Funktion kompiliere, bekomme ich:
%Vor%
Im Tutorial heißt das, dass ich versuche, eine Funkti...
03.11.2009, 13:05
In fortran können wir Standardargumente definieren. Wenn ein optionales Argument nicht vorhanden ist, kann es auch nicht festgelegt werden. Wenn Sie Argumente als Schlüsselwortargumente mit Standardwerten verwenden, führt dies zu umständlichen K...
09.06.2016, 10:55
C # und F # haben unterschiedliche Implementierungen der Standardparameter (oder optionalen Parameter).
In der C # -Sprache, wenn Sie dem Argument einen Standardwert hinzufügen, ändern Sie nicht den zugrunde liegenden Typ (ich meine den Typ d...
13.04.2013, 14:34